If you read the 08 owners manual (you can dl it from the nissan website), you will see that there are 3 types of climate controls on the Titan.
1. The older 3knob climate control that the 04-07s had
2. The non dual climate control that has 2 knobs and several buttons all bundled on the bottom of the bezel.
3. The dual climate control
1 looks like you can use the older kits to install a new radio but 2 and 3 needs a new bezel and kit to work.

dakestar: Congrats on the successful install. Just so we have a little bit of history here we can add for others and myself, can you tell us what kind of climate controls you have? Do you have the 3 older style knobs?
Also since you said the 07 aftermarket harness did not work, what did you do to tap into the factory harness wires? What were those 2 wires you had to swap?
After I found that the harness would not work I hard wired to the pioneer harness. There were two identical color wires - one was the dimmer I think and the other was a speaker wire. I was getting full power but no sound. Once I switched them out the pioneer worked like a charm.
Also one thing of note: the radio antenna was not your standard connection - it had its own weird harness. Crutchfield sells an adapter for 07 and newer Nissans to accomodate...
